Transaction 740e159de783ef66eba4dc5e03fcca417f86dedb4de97474c46071d27e92cf7d

1 Input
2 Outputs
  • 740e159de783ef66eba4dc5e03fcca417f86dedb4de97474c46071d27e92cf7d:0
  • value  3000000
    address  3FbdWDFFm4C8UTVFSYhWw5NywmZpi4rRSf
  • 740e159de783ef66eba4dc5e03fcca417f86dedb4de97474c46071d27e92cf7d:1
  • value  96960328
    address  3HrZomZiVsA8cC2a8KwNpp5ZVY8HEPHba4